Bitozeves (German: Witosess) is a municipality and village in Louny District in the Ústí nad Labem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 600 inhabitants.
Bitozeves lies approximately 12 kilometres (7 mi) west of Louny, 44 km (27 mi) south-west of Ústí nad Labem, and 65 km (40 mi) north-west of Prague.
Administrative parts
Villages of Nehasice, Tatinná and Vidovle, and the area of the industrial zone called Bitozeves-Průmyslová zóna Triangle are administrative parts of Bitozeves.
